Here is how to rewrite your movement practice: Look at the Instagram accounts you follow. Do they make you feel motivated or inadequate? Unfollow any account that uses "skinny" as the default good. Follow accounts that show diverse bodies lifting, stretching, swimming, and dancing. 2. Separate movement from compensation If you are walking only because you ate a cookie, stop. You are teaching your brain that food is poison and exercise is the antidote. Instead, walk because the sun feels good. Walk because it helps you think. 3. Explore "non-aesthetic" modalities Yoga is excellent if the teacher focuses on alignment and breath, not "tucking your ribs." Swimming is incredible because the water supports you regardless of joint pain. Martial arts and dance focus on what the body can do . If a class makes you weigh yourself or take measurements, walk out. 4. The "Feel Good" rule After a workout, ask: Do I feel better than before? If you feel exhausted, ashamed, or sore to the point of pain, that exercise belongs to diet culture. If you feel loose, warm, energized, or relaxed—that is body positive wellness. Part 4: Intuitive Eating (The Anti-Diet) You cannot have a body positive lifestyle without addressing nutrition. Diet culture wants you to believe you cannot trust your body. It says your hunger is a liar, your cravings are enemies, and your fullness is a trap.
